2023-04-18T14:35:52.37+00:00 Hello there, First suggestion would be to verify the checklist here https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/configmgr/core/servers/manage/checklist-for-installing-update-2211 If the update displays as Downloading and doesn't change, review the hman.log and dmpdownloader.log for errors. The dmpdownloader.log may indicate that the dmpdownloader process is waiting for an interval before checking for updates. To restart the download of the update's redistribution files, restart the SMS_Executive service on the site server. Another common download issue occurs when proxy server settings prevent downloads from required internet endpoints.
